"Gastie's" (too tonguebreaking word to always write down, lol) tend to pose very front of the screen :)
If they are bit black'n'white (or green-black) on back and red chest or belly or all over, then they must be "Gastie" males - no other fish here looks like a tiny parrot, lol.
Other silverbellies-little b'n'w or b'n'g back are then probably their females. Interesting is, that many females are chasing to one male. They all give birth to one nest (females definitely seem fat, so they obviously still have their eggs) and then they leave, and male fish will guard and ventilate the nest.
